Powering the Transition: e-Fuels for Heavy-Duty Vehicles
As the world shifts towards zero-emission transport, the electrification of heavy-duty vehicles presents unique challenges. e-Fuels, or synthetic fuels produced using renewable energy, offer a promising solution to decarbonize this critical sector. This essay explores the potential of e-Fuels in accelerating the transition to sustainable transportation for heavy-duty vehicles.
Unlocking Potential:
e-Fuels are synthesized from renewable sources such as hydrogen and captured carbon dioxide, offering a carbon-neutral alternative to conventional fossil fuels. They can be seamlessly integrated into existing infrastructure and vehicle fleets, eliminating the need for costly infrastructure upgrades.
Driving Sustainability:
By utilizing e-Fuels, heavy-duty vehicles can significantly reduce their carbon footprint without compromising performance or range. e-Fuels offer a pathway to achieving emissions targets while maintaining the versatility and reliability demanded by the transportation industry.
Overcoming Challenges:
Challenges such as scalability and cost remain hurdles to widespread adoption. However, ongoing advancements in production processes and supportive policies are paving the way for the commercialization of e-Fuels on a larger scale.
e-Fuels hold immense potential in powering the transition to zero-emission heavy-duty transport. Through innovation, collaboration, and supportive policies, e-Fuels can play a pivotal role in achieving a sustainable future for transportation.
